BBK Corporation Set to Unveil Next-Gen Smartphones with 6000mAh Batteries

China’s mobile technology is gearing up for a power-packed upgrade as BBK Corporation readies to unveil a new series of flagship smartphones with impressive enhancements. A glimpse into the tech future reveals that the anticipated OnePlus 13, OPPO Find X8, and Realme GT6 Pro models will boast a robust 6000 mAh battery capacity. This marks a significant shift from the current industry standard, where most high-end Chinese smartphones come equipped with 5400-5500 mAh batteries.

Beyond battery life, these devices are set to supercharge user experience with support for rapid charging capabilities, allowing for power-ups at lightning speeds of up to 100W. In the heart of these advanced handsets, a Snapdragon 8 Gen 4 processor promises to deliver top-tier performance, showcasing the blend of longevity and speed.

While tech enthusiasts eagerly anticipate these launches, the release of the OnePlus 13, OPPO Find X8, and Realme GT6 Pro is not immediately around the corner. Current projections suggest these flagships will be introduced at the tail end of 2024 or potentially early into 2025, setting the stage for a new chapter in smartphone innovation by BBK Corporation.

Key Questions and Answers:

1. What is BBK Corporation?
BBK Corporation is a Chinese multinational corporation that owns several popular smartphone brands, including OnePlus, OPPO, Vivo, and Realme. It is one of the largest smartphone manufacturers in the world.

2. Why is a 6000mAh battery significant?
A 6000mAh battery offers a higher capacity compared to the prevalent 5400-5500 mAh batteries in high-end smartphones, potentially providing longer battery life and extended usage times between charges, which is a key factor for users who rely on their smartphone for various daily activities.

3. What are the advantages of rapid charging capabilities?
Rapid charging capabilities can significantly reduce the time required to recharge the smartphone’s battery, enhancing convenience for users by ensuring they can get enough power for several hours of use in just a few minutes.

4. Are there any challenges or controversies associated with the topic?
The main challenges may include ensuring battery safety and longevity, as higher capacities and rapid charging can put additional strain on the battery. Additionally, there can be concerns about heat management during charging and the environmental impact of producing and disposing of larger batteries.

Advantages and Disadvantages:

The anticipated launch of the new smartphone series by BBK Corporation with 6000mAh batteries offers various advantages:
Extended Battery Life: The increased capacity can facilitate longer usage times, reducing the need for frequent charging.
Enhanced Performance: Integration with the Snapdragon 8 Gen 4 processor will offer powerful performance capabilities, likely improving multitasking and handling of resource-intensive applications.
Rapid Charging: With the promise of up to 100W charging speeds, users could experience reduced downtime when charging their devices.

However, there are also several disadvantages to consider:
Increased Size and Weight: Larger batteries can make smartphones heavier and potentially larger, affecting their portability and ergonomics.
Battery Degradation: Faster charging can accelerate battery degradation over time, affecting the device’s longevity.
Heat Generation: Rapid charging can generate more heat, which might require advanced cooling solutions or could lead to reduced battery effectiveness over time.
Environmental Concerns: Larger batteries utilize more resources and potentially lead to more electronic waste if not recycled properly.
